Sorry for the silence. Over the last week our family has been distended as we work through the grief of Trung's mysterious disappearance and bringing in the Year of the Snake without him. What is usually a celebratory occasion was somber.

We want Trung home no matter what has happened to him. As his aunt alluded to on the news segment, alive would be best but if dead, we still want him home so that we can properly care for his physical body. We continue to search for Trung and to reach out to as many people as possible every day.

Please know that we are trying our best to stay on top of everything. Currently, LE is investigating every possible lead and we have been asked to continue our focus on spreading the word about Trung's disappearance, especially through social network sites such as Facebook, as it has been the most productive source of leads for the detectives covering the case. We need to direct our energy towards raising greater awareness. As you all have been so incredibly helpful thus far with your words of encouragement, suggestions, and support, please visit and share/like our dedicated Facebook page. It may seem like a small act on your part but it could mean bringing us one degree closer to someone who might've seen or heard something.

STOCKTON, CA - They're calling him John Doe for now but Stockton police would very much like to learn the real name of a man whose body was discovered in the Stockton Deep Water Channel on March 30.

The sketch and physical description of this UID strongly resembles Trung but according to comments on the family's Facebook update today, they have learned the UID has no tattoos and Trung has 4.
